In recent news from the Nebraska real estate market, industry experts are reporting a significant surge in demand for properties across the state. As of July 22, 2025, record low interest rates and a robust economy are fueling a buying frenzy among both local residents and out-of-state investors.According to data from the Nebraska Realtors Association, home sales have reached their highest levels in years, with a 15% year-over-year increase in closed transactions. This trend is particularly evident in the major urban centers of Omaha and Lincoln, where bidding wars have become commonplace for properties in sought-after neighborhoods.One of the key factors contributing to this red-hot market is the influx of remote workers seeking affordable housing options with a high quality of life. With many companies embracing remote work arrangements, professionals are no longer tied to expensive coastal cities and are increasingly looking to the Midwest for affordable, spacious homes.In addition, Nebraska's strong agricultural sector has bolstered the state's economy, providing a stable foundation for job growth and attracting new residents looking for employment opportunities. This influx of people has led to a shortage of available properties, driving up prices and creating a competitive market for buyers.Real estate developers are seizing the opportunity to meet this heightened demand, with several new housing developments in the pipeline in suburban areas surrounding major cities. These projects aim to provide more housing inventory to accommodate the growing population and alleviate some of the pressure on the market.Despite the rapid pace of sales and rising home prices, experts are cautiously optimistic about the sustainability of the current real estate boom. They point to factors such as rising construction costs and potential interest rate hikes as potential challenges that could dampen the market in the future.For now, however, the Nebraska real estate market shows no signs of slowing down, with buyers eager to capitalize on favorable market conditions and secure their piece of the Heartland. As the state continues to attract new residents and investors, the future looks bright for Nebraska's real estate sector.
